### LED Matrix Effect Typing Heatmap {#led-matrix-effect-typing-heatmap}
|
||||
|
||||
This effect will scale the LED matrix brightness according to a heatmap of recently pressed keys. Whenever a key is pressed its "temperature" increases as well as that of its neighboring keys. The temperature of each key is then decreased automatically every 25 milliseconds by default.
|
||||
|
||||
In order to change the delay of temperature decrease define `LED_MATRIX_TYPING_HEATMAP_DECREASE_DELAY_MS`:
|
||||
|
||||
```c
|
||||
#define LED_MATRIX_TYPING_HEATMAP_DECREASE_DELAY_MS 50
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
As heatmap uses the physical position of the leds set in the g_led_config, you may need to tweak the following options to get the best effect for your keyboard. Note the size of this grid is `224x64`.
|
||||
|
||||
Limit the distance the effect spreads to surrounding keys.
|
||||
|
||||
```c
|
||||
#define LED_MATRIX_TYPING_HEATMAP_SPREAD 40
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Limit how hot surrounding keys get from each press.
|
||||
|
||||
```c
|
||||
#define LED_MATRIX_TYPING_HEATMAP_AREA_LIMIT 16
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Remove the spread effect entirely.
|
||||
|
||||
```c
|
||||
#define LED_MATRIX_TYPING_HEATMAP_SLIM
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
It's also possible to adjust the tempo of *heating up*. It's defined as the number of steps by which to increment the brightness. Decreasing this value increases the number of keystrokes needed to fully heat up the key.
|
||||
|
||||
```c
|
||||
#define LED_MATRIX_TYPING_HEATMAP_INCREASE_STEP 32
|
||||
```
